§Standalone Clari Copilot: The Wingman Successor

Clari acquired Wingman in 2022 for an undisclosed amount and rebranded the product as Clari Copilot. The standalone product surface remained largely intact: call recording across Zoom, Teams, Google Meet, and major telephony providers; transcription and conversation analytics; deal-risk tracking driven by language signals; coaching scorecards; battle cards triggered by mention detection; Salesforce and HubSpot integration.

Standalone Clari Copilot in 2026 prices in line with the original Wingman pricing band of $120 to $160 per user per month. This compares favourably to Gong Foundation at $1,298 to $1,600 per user per year on the per-user line, and meaningfully better once Gong's $5,000 to $50,000 platform fee is included. For a 10-seat sales team that wants enterprise-class conversation intelligence without bundle entanglement, standalone Clari Copilot is one of the price-leaders in the revenue intelligence category.

The standalone path has lost relative weight inside Clari's sales motion as Clari has invested in the Revenue Platform narrative. Clari's sales team will push the bundle by default; standalone is available but requires explicit insistence at the procurement table.

§Clari Revenue Platform: The Bundle Story

Clari positions the Revenue Platform as a single integrated stack covering the full sales cycle: pipeline visibility, forecasting, deal review, conversation intelligence, and sales engagement. The bundle includes:

Clari Forecast (the original product)

Deal-by-deal forecast roll-up, pipeline health analytics, AI-driven deal-risk scoring, multi-period forecast snapshots. This is the product Clari was built on and where most enterprise buyer ROI conversations start.

Clari Align (deal-review workflow)

Structured deal review meetings, mutual action plans with prospects, deal score cards, account-team coordination. Used by enterprise RevOps teams running formal deal review cadences.

Clari Copilot (conversation intelligence)

The former Wingman product. Call recording, transcription, AI analytics, coaching scorecards, battle cards. Comparable in feature surface to Gong Foundation.

Clari Groove (sales engagement)

The former Groove product, acquired in 2023. Sales engagement sequencer, multi-channel cadence, email tracking. Competes with Salesloft, Outreach, and Gong Engage.

Bundled per-user pricing for the Revenue Platform runs $2,500 to $5,000 per user per year depending on which sub-products are activated. Most enterprise contracts include Forecast plus Copilot plus Groove at minimum; Align is typically a higher-tier add-on.

§When the Bundle Pays Off

The Revenue Platform bundle wins on three criteria: (1) you are running multi-vendor RevOps tooling that the bundle replaces (Salesloft plus Gong plus a separate forecasting tool), (2) you need integrated deal-risk signals across forecasting and conversation intelligence (a unified deal score rather than two separate scores), and (3) you have RevOps maturity to operate the Align workflow rather than running deal reviews in spreadsheets.

For teams that already have a working Salesloft plus Gong stack, the bundle replacement is a heavy migration: re-training reps on Groove, re-wiring CRM integrations from Gong to Clari, re-building Salesloft sequences in Groove. The migration cost typically takes 6 to 9 months of distraction and is rarely worth the consolidation savings.

For green-field teams building a RevOps stack from scratch, the bundle is more compelling because the migration cost does not exist. Clari positions strongly here against Gong plus Salesloft plus Salesforce-Forecast combinations.

Is Clari Copilot still the Wingman product?
Yes, with significant integration depth added since the 2022 acquisition. The core conversation intelligence engine, call recording, and Salesforce integration remain Wingman-derived. New features (AI deal scoring linked to Clari Forecast signals, integrated battle cards via Groove) reflect the post-acquisition Clari investment.
Can I buy Clari Forecast without Copilot?
Yes. Clari Forecast was the original product and is sold standalone at custom pricing typically in the $2,000 to $4,000 per user per year range. Most Forecast-only contracts are at enterprise volume. The standalone Forecast deal often serves as the entry point that Clari sales then upsells into the full Revenue Platform bundle at renewal.
Does Clari Copilot integrate with Salesloft and Outreach?
Yes, both sequencers integrate cleanly with Clari Copilot for call capture and analytics. The integration story is one of the standalone Copilot's strengths: it does not assume you have moved your sequencer to Clari Groove. This makes Copilot standalone a viable choice for teams committed to Salesloft or Outreach long-term.
What is Clari Groove?
Clari Groove is the sales engagement product Clari acquired through the Groove SaaS acquisition in 2023. It is a direct competitor to Salesloft and Outreach. Standalone Groove pricing runs around $1,000 to $1,500 per user per year; bundled inside the Revenue Platform it adds incremental per-user fee on top of Forecast plus Copilot.
How does Clari compare to Salesforce Revenue Cloud + Einstein?
Clari is the third-party best-of-breed alternative to Salesforce's first-party Revenue Cloud (formerly CPQ Billing) plus Einstein Conversation Insights stack. Clari's strengths over Salesforce: deeper AI deal-risk signals, faster product iteration, conversation intelligence quality. Salesforce's strengths over Clari: deeper integration with the underlying CRM, single-vendor procurement story, native data without ETL hops.
What is Clari's renewal price increase?
Clari defaults to 5 to 8 percent year-on-year price increases on renewal. Multi-year contracts with a price-lock cap negotiated in the original deal can compress the increase to 0 to 3 percent. Without a cap, Year 2 renewal price increases routinely surprise procurement teams.
